Infravision works fine, it provides a significant boost to minimum nighttime visibility. I MIGHT tweak it a little bit more, but certainly not enough to satisfy people who claim that there's "no difference" between human and Infravision, which is just silly. If you have evidence that Infravision is actually not applying in certain areas or under certain circumstances, please provide screenshots and a /loc. That's actionable. "There is no difference between Infravision and human vision" is patently false and not actionable. | |||
